Description
The file consists of country wise database of whole world related to bioeconomy typology indicators collected from different online sources with following headings which are as follows: Importance of bio-based economic sectors in agriculture, Forestry, High-tech bioeconomy and bioenergy, Natural Resources Endownment, Evaluate against indicator of Bioeconomy strategy, value added sector data, Fragile state indexes, Income inequality and gini coeffiecient, social progress index. Quality/Lineage: The data were downloaded from different sources and arranged as per the countries database in a single table. Purpose: The data was collected to analyze the bioeconomy status in the countries of the whole world.
